About AMP

AMP designs, builds, operates, and services AI-powered sortation systems for waste managers in the public and private sectors. AMP's material identification and advanced automation technology—with hundreds of deployments across North America, Asia, and Europe—enhances the safety and reliability of waste facilities while increasing recovery and landfill diversion. By bringing digital intelligence to recycling, AMP sorts waste streams and extracts value beyond what is otherwise possible. AMP's AI uses deep learning to continuously train itself by processing millions of material images into data. The software uses pattern recognition of colors, textures, shapes, sizes, and logos to identify recyclables and contaminants in real time, enabling new offtake chemistries and capabilities. AMP's first products were a series of sorting robots deployed with minimal retrofit into existing recycling facilities. The company then pioneered a series of next-generation, transformative recycling facilities. With near-zero manual sorting, unprecedented reliability, and pervasive data, these facilities make the recovery of commodities safer and more cost-effective than ever and have grown to encompass municipal solid waste (MSW) sorting, an offering out of reach to the industry prior to the advent of AMP's technology.
